The Vintage Fashion Guild™ (VFG) is an international organization dedicated to the promotion and preservation of vintage fashion.
The Vintage Fashion Guild™ (VFG) is an international community of people with expertise in vintage fashion. VFG members enjoy a wealth of resources, avenues for promoting their shops and specialties, and camaraderie with others who share a common interest and passion.
Beginning in the 1970s, Native Hawaiian designer Allen Akina (1940–1991) produced fashions under several labels in Hawaiʻi. His mostly custom made, hand silk-screened fabric designs reference Hawaiian culture and its people in his paintings, illustrations, and textiles.
